The new year starts rather slow, with few touring musicians coming to New York City until later in the month. Chuck Prophet is coming to New York City this week. Other than that, the music offerings this week are by our very talented local musicians.
The Manhattan Beat regularly lists the best live music events coming to New York City. The twice-weekly listings also celebrate via photographs some of the musicians who have performed locally in the past few days.
Everynight Charley recommends the following 30+ live music events this week in New York City. Contact the venue to confirm ticket availability, show times, COVID compliance, and other updates. Note that several artists and indoor venues continue to require proof of COVID vaccinations and/or mandate the wearing of masks.
